== Middle English ==
=== Etymology 1 ===
From Old English smiþþe, from Proto-Germanic *smiþjǭ. Doublet of smythy (from the same Proto-Germanic word through Old Norse smiðja).
==== Alternative forms ====
smiððe, smyþþe, smiþe, smiðe
==== Pronunciation ====
IPA(key): /ˈsmiθ(ə)/
==== Noun ====
smythe (plural smythes)
smithy
===== Descendants =====
English: smithe (obsolete)
